Created attachment 1351628 [details] rpm built from F20 srpm Description of problem: EPEL currently has fcitx-anthy available. However, anthy seems to have been dead upstream for a long time now. Due to various reasons, apparently RH and Fedora aren't using mozc (See https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Features/libkkc) ibus-kkc is already available. The srpm from https://archive.fedoraproject.org/pub/archive/fedora/linux/releases/20/Everything/source/SRPMS/f/fcitx-kkc-0.1.0-3.fc20.src.rpm rebuilds on CentOS-7 without modification so it seems it would be fairly simple to make fcitx-kkc available. Additional info: Rebuilt rpm attached. Done by just getting the srpm and running rpmbuild -ba on the spec file.
This, of course, will benefit many Japanese users (like myself) in addition to those who work with the Japanese language.
